Web27 de jul. de 2024 · Evictions in San Francisco have additional protections pursuant to the rent control laws, called the Ellis Act. A landlord is not permitted to simply evict a tenant by locking them out of a residence or cutting off their utilities, known as self help evictions. Instead, a landlord is required to follow the proper court process.
